Explanation

 

Council Variance Application:  CV21-002

 

APPLICANT:  Kreais LLC; c/o David Hodge, Atty.; Underhill & Hodge, LLC; 8000 Walton Parkway, Suite 260; New Albany, OH 43054.

 

PROPOSED USE:  A single-unit dwelling and a single-unit carriage house on one lot.    

 

COLUMBUS SOUTH SIDE AREA COMMISSION RECOMMENDATION:  Approval.

                                                                               

CITY DEPARTMENTS' RECOMMENDATION: Approval.  The site is developed with a single-unit dwelling in the R-2F, Residential District. The applicant requests a Council variance to permit a carriage house and a single-unit dwelling on one parcel. The variance is necessary because while the R-2F district permits two-unit dwellings, two single-unit dwellings on the same lot are prohibited. Variances to minimum number of parking spaces required, area district requirements, lot with, lot coverage, fronting, maximum and minimum side yard, and rear yard are included in this request. The site is located within the boundaries of the South Side Plan (2014), which recommends “Medium-High Density Residential” land uses at this location. Additionally, the Plan includes early adoption of the Columbus Citywide Planning Policies (C2P2) Design Guidelines (2018).  Planning Division staff has determined that the proposed building elevations include design elements that are compatible with surrounding structures.

Body

 

WHEREAS, by application #CV21-002, the owner of property at 374 E. WHITTIER ST. (43206), is requesting a Council variance to permit a single-unit dwelling (a carriage house) on the rear of a lot developed with a single-unit dwelling with reduced development standards in the R-2F, Residential District;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.037, R-2F, residential district, permits a maximum of two units in one building, but prohibits two single-unit dwellings on one lot, while the applicant proposes to develop a dwelling unit above a garage (carriage house) on a lot developed with a single-unit dwelling;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3312.49, Minimum numbers of parking spaces required, requires two parking spaces per dwelling unit, or four spaces total for two units, while the applicant proposes three parking spaces;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.05(A), Area district lot width requirements, requires a minimum lot width of 50 feet in the R-2F, Residential District, while the applicant proposes to conform the existing lot width of  33 feet;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.14, R-2F area district requirements, requires a single-unit dwelling or other principal building to be situated on a lot of no less than 6,000 square feet in area, while the applicant proposes two separate single-unit dwellings on a lot that contains 3,267 square feet totaling 1,634 square feet of lot area per dwelling unit;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.19, Fronting on a public street, requires a dwelling unit to have frontage on a public street, while the applicant proposes for the rear carriage house dwelling to front on the public alley;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.25, Maximum side yards required, requires the sum of the widths of the side yards to equal or exceed 20 percent of the width of the lot, or 6.6 feet, while the applicant proposes to maintain a maximum side yard of zero feet; and

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.26(C)(1), Minimum side yard permitted, requires a minimum side yard of three feet, while the applicant proposes to maintain minimum side yards of zero feet; and 

 

WHEREAS, Section 3332.27, Rear yard, requires a rear yard totaling no less than 25 percent of the total lot area, while the applicant proposes 11 percent rear yard for the existing single-unit dwelling, and no rear yard for the rear carriage house dwelling; and

 

WHEREAS, the Columbus South Side Area Commission recommends approval; and

 

WHEREAS, City Departments recommend approval because the requested variances would permit development of a carriage house in character and scale with the dwellings on the surrounding properties; and 

 

WHEREAS, said ordinance requires separate submission for all applicable permits and a Certificate of Occupancy for the proposed carriage house; and

 

WHEREAS, said variance will not adversely affect the surrounding property or surrounding neighborhood; and

 

WHEREAS, the granting of said variance will not impair an adequate supply of light and air to adjacent properties or unreasonably increase the congestion of public streets, or unreasonably diminish or impair established property values within the surrounding area, or otherwise impair the public health, safety, comfort, morals, or welfare of the inhabitants of the City of Columbus; and

 

WHEREAS, the granting of said variance will alleviate the difficulties encountered by the owners of the property located at 374 E. WHITTIER ST. (43206), in using said property as desired; now, therefore:
